Distinguishing Between Security and Safer Gambling Tools
You must separate session timeouts from the wider set of safer gambling tools. Deposit limits and reality checks directly track how you spend. Session timeouts are mainly a security protocol. During our review, we found that Great Slots Casino includes both, but they do different jobs. The timeout doesn’t track your bets or losses. It just checks whether you’re actually doing anything. We think this distinction matters for UK players. It positions the timeout not as a clamp on your fun but as a technical shield operating in the background, keeping your account safe.

Activity Alerts as a Complementary, Not Alternative, Tool
During our quest for customization, we did find solid reality check settings. People often mistake them with session timeouts, but they serve a different purpose. Reality checks are pop-up reminders that interrupt gameplay after a set period of continuous activity, requiring you to acknowledge how long you’ve been playing. We could set these to appear hourly or more often. They don’t log you out. They just pause the action. We used these alongside the automatic timeout to build a wider safety net, but we still couldn’t change the core inactivity logout timer itself.

Slot Autoplay and the Inactivity Paradox
This is where things get interesting. Autoplay functions rotate the reels automatically for a set number of rounds. You’d think that activity maintains the session alive. Our testing uncovered a more tangled reality. While the reels spin, the session stays active because the software processes transactions. But once the autoplay cycle ends and the screen sits idle on the win/loss summary, the inactivity timer starts running. We discovered that if you set a long autoplay session and walk away, you might come back to find yourself logged out right after the final spin, even if you intended to keep playing.
